di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ml index dfa4e14dfe02741928c7515930fe3e606916a6cd..6e43134b42369f28374adc50a2dbb0cfa384e8fd 100644 --- a/.gitlab-ci.yml +++ b/.gitlab-ci.yml @@ -1,11 +1,17 @@ --- -before: +image: python:2 + +variables: + PIP_CACHE_DIR: "$CI_PROJECT_DIR/pip-cache" + +cache: + paths: + - "$CI_PROJECT_DIR/pip-cache" + key: "$CI_PROJECT_ID" + +test: script: - - apt install python-pip - pip install ansible - ansible --version - printf '[defaults]\nroles_path=../' >ansible.cfg - -playbook: - script: - - ansible-playbook tests/test.yml -i tests/inventory --syntax-check + - ansible-playbook tests/test.yml -i tests/inventory --syntax-check